honored to become a 2017 Hellman Fellow

I am honored to become a 2017 Hellman Fellow. The fellowship supports our project studying how novel Toxoplasma virulence factors manipulate CD8 T cell responses. This is a huge honor, and I am excited to see where the project goes next. Thanks to the Hellman Fellowship Program!
